Our online Discrete Math tutors offer personalized, one-on-one learning to help you improve your grades, build your confidence, and achieve your academic goals.
Top 165 online Discrete Math tutors

16 years of tutoring
English, French, Persian
Calgary, Canada
CAD $80/hr
16 years of tutoring
English, French, Persian
Calgary, Canada
University of Sherbrooke, University of Manitoba, Isfahan University of Technology, Isfahan University of technology
I’m Reza, a Ph.D. in Mathematics with teaching experience spanning worldwide since 2009, helping students excel in mathematics with clarity, confidence, and enjoyment. With ⭐⭐⭐⭐⭐ ratings from more than 100 learners, I specialize in breaking down complex ideas into simple, intuitive, and engaging explanations. I have taught at Canadian universities, school boards, academic centers, and leading global online platforms, supporting students from high school to graduate studies. Every lesson is tailored — whether you're aiming to improve grades, master university-level math, prepare for exams, or strengthen problem-solving skills. 📚 Teaching Subjects: Algebra, Calculus, Linear Algebra, Real Analysis, Complex Analysis, Abstract Algebra, Discrete Mathematics, Number Theory, Set Theory, Graph Theory, Topology, Ordinary Differential Equations (ODEs), Partial Differential Equations (PDEs), Geometry, Trigonometry, Probability & Statistics 🌟 Why students choose me: Proven results: stronger grades, deeper understanding, lasting confidence Personalized instruction: adapted to learning style, pace, and goals Broad experience: students from Canada, the U.S., Europe, Asia, and beyond Engaging online learning: clear explanations, step-by-step reasoning, real-time support If you’re ready to stop struggling and start excelling, I’d be happy to help you make math your strength — let’s begin!
read moreSubjects: Abstract Algebra, Algebra, Calculus, Complex analysis, Differential Equations, Discrete Math, Integral Calculus, Linear Algebra, Multivariable Calculus, Number Theory, Ordinary and Partial Differential Equations, Real Analysis, Topology

6 years of tutoring
English, Hindi, Gujarati
Kalyan, India
USD $32/hr
6 years of tutoring
English, Hindi, Gujarati
Kalyan, India
Pune University
Hi there! I'm Dhaval Furia, a dedicated Math tutor with a Master’s degree in Mathematics and over 5 years of experience helping students conquer math with clarity and confidence. In a world full of AI tools and auto-solvers, here's why students still choose me: ✅ I teach you how to think, not just what to write. AI can give you answers. I help you understand why those answers work, so you can solve problems even when AI tools aren’t allowed (like in exams!). ✅ Real-time feedback. No waiting, no guessing. If you're stuck or confused, I spot the issue immediately and adjust the explanation to fit your learning style. ✅ Personalized strategies. Struggling with word problems? Making careless mistakes? Need help managing time during tests? I customize my approach to target your exact pain points. ------------------------------------------------------------------------------------------------ 🟢 Just starting your course? Let’s build your foundation early. Students who work with me from day one typically see better grades and less stress. 🔴 Already stuck mid-course? I offer limited support for urgent help; but remember, understanding takes time. It’s always better to start before the panic sets in. ------------------------------------------------------------------------------------------------ 📅 Not sure yet? Book a free 15-minute consultation to see if we’re the right fit. No pressure. Just a conversation about your goals and how I can help you reach them. ------------------------------------------------------------------------------------------------ If you're ready to move beyond “just getting the answer” and actually master math, let’s get started. Math doesn’t have to be hard, especially when you’re not learning alone.
read moreSubjects: AP Calculus AB/BC, Algebra, Calculus, College Algebra, Competition Math, Discrete Math, Finite Mathematics, Linear Algebra, Math, Maths, Multivariable Calculus, Pre-Calculus, Proofs, Trigonometry, Vector Calculus

15 years of tutoring
Persian, English
Tehran, Iran
USD $35/hr
15 years of tutoring
Persian, English
Tehran, Iran
Imam Khomeini International University
Are you struggling with math? Do you have trouble understanding electrical engineering concepts? Do you want to improve your grades? You have got to the right person. That's what I'm here for to help you with! ACADEMICL BIOGRAPHY: I have got my PhD in electrical engineering in 2018. I have been teaching at high school and university levels since 2011. Currently, I am an assistant professor (Part-time) in both Islamic Azad University of Tehran and Tehran University of Applied Science and Technology. I have deep experience in teaching at high school and university levels. I have also a rich experience of private tutoring in mathematics and physics at high school and university levels. I also teach the subjects and software related to electrical engineering both at university and privately. My careful observations of the teaching styles and methods that I experienced throughout my education and work, provide a valuable collection of effective teaching techniques from which I draw to meet my students' personal and educational needs. Therefore, I strongly invite you to book a trial session with me.
read moreSubjects: Calculus, Deep Learning, Discrete Math, Electrical Circuit Analysis, Electrical Engineering, Machine Learning, Math, Physics, Physics (Electricity and Magnetism), Python

8 years of tutoring
English, Japanese
Toronto, Canada
CAD $50/hr
8 years of tutoring
English, Japanese
Toronto, Canada
McMaster University
I welcome you to experience an engaging and interactive tutoring session with me. I will do my best to give you an active role in the session - small discussions here and there, "try it yourself" practice bouts and full-solution walkthroughs afterwards, as well as visual tools and illustrations to help you "see" the math or programming concept we are discussing. - Experience - I have been tutoring for 8 years through TutorOcean and in-person private tutoring. I've held over 500 sessions and helped many students in various fields, especially in Engineering and Science disciplines, achieve their academic goals. Students have often described sessions as easy to follow and well-explained. - Courses & Topics - - Calculus & Vectors - Linear Algebra - Calculus I - Calculus II - Advanced Functions Grade 11 (including IB SL/HL) - Advanced Functions Grade 12 (including IB SL/HL ) - Introduction to Statistics and Probability - Introduction to Programming - Discrete - Concurrent Programming - Introduction to Programming in Java - Introduction to Programming in Python - Data Structures and Algorithms in Java - Data Structures and Algorithms in Python - Elementary Mathematics (Grades 1 - 8) - Secondary Mathematics (Grades 9 - 12)
read moreSubjects: Calculus, Discrete Math, ESL, English as a Second Language (ESL), Functions, Integral Calculus, Java, Linear Algebra, Multivariable Calculus, Object Oriented Programming, Parallel Processing, Pre-Calculus, Python, TESL, Vector Calculus

13 years of tutoring
English, Hindi
Bathinda, India
CAD $30/hr
13 years of tutoring
English, Hindi
Bathinda, India
DAV college, Jalandhar, Guru Nanak Dev University
I am an experienced mathematics and statistics tutor with 10 years of experience teaching students and working professionals. I love teaching students who are passionate about learning subjects or who want to understand any mathematics or statistics concept at the graduate or master’s level. I have worked with thousands of students in my teaching career. I have helped students deal with difficult topics and subjects like calculus, algebra, discrete mathematics, complex analysis, graph theory, hypothesis testing, probability, statistical inference, and more. After learning from me, students have found mathematics and statistics not dull but fun subjects. I can handle almost all of the curriculum in mathematics. I did B.Sc (mathematics), M.Sc (mathematics), M.Tech (IT) and am also Gate (CS) qualified. I have worked in various colleges and schools and also provided online tutoring to American and Canadian students. I look forward to discussing this with you and making learning meaningful and purposeful. I can teach UBC Math 110, UBC Math 100, UBC Math 100C,UBC Math 101A,UBC Math 101B, UBC Math 101C,UBC Math 180, UBC Math 184, UBC Math 104, UBC Math 102, UBC Math 105, UBC Math 103, UBC Math 200, UBC Math 253, UBC Math 221, UBC Math 215; UBC Math 255; UBC Math 256; and UBC Stat 200. TRU Math 1141, TRU Math 1241, TRU Math 1171, Langara Math 1174, Langara Math 1274, Langara Math 1171, Langara Math 1271, SFU Math 150, SFU Math 151, SFU Math 152, SFU Math 155, SFU Math 157, SFU Math 158, SFU Math 251, SFU Math 310, SFU Math 260, UBC Math 101, UBC Math 105, UBC Math 103, UBC Math 116, UBC Math 225, UBC Math 142, VCC Math 1100, VCC Math 1200 STAT 1200,1201,2000.Ottawa MAT 1300, 1308, 1318, 1320, 1322, 1330, 1339; Corpus Christi College Math 105, 110, 111. McMaster Math 1A03; 1AA3; 1MM3; 1M03; 1ZA3; 1ZB3; 1AA3; UVIC Math 100; 101; 102; 109; 200. AP Calculus AB/BC Athabasca University (AU) Math 260, 265, 266; 270, 271; 365, 376.
read moreSubjects: AP Calculus AB/BC, AP Statistics, Algebra, Algebra 1, Algebra 2, Calculus, Discrete Math, Linear Algebra, Math/Science, Multivariable Calculus, Ordinary and Partial Differential Equations, Pre-Calculus, Probability, Statistics, Trigonometry
How it works
Discover a vast selection of online tutors who specialize in your course. Our online tutors cover all subjects and levels, so you can easily find the perfect match for your needs.
Schedule a session with your online tutor via desktop or mobile. Collaborate with your tutor and learn effectively in real-time.
Connect with your online tutor through our interactive online classroom. Share your course syllabus and create a customized plan for success.
Why TutorOcean
Our online tutors offer personalized, one-on-one learning to help you improve your grades, build your confidence, and achieve your academic goals.

Unified platform
Success stories
“Akshay is an exceptional Pre-calculus tutor for university-level students. He has a great way of explaining complex concepts and ensures that his students understand them. He is always ready to provide additional explanations if needed. I highly recommend him and look forward to booking him again.” — Sasha

“Richard is an exceptional tutor who has the ability to explain complex concepts in a simplistic way. His step-by-step instructions help to build confidence and understand the material better. Furthermore, he provides numerous tips and resources to facilitate success.” — Jessica

“I had a session on Linear Algebra, and it was very helpful. Mirjana was excellent in explaining matrices, and I could understand the concepts quite well. I would definitely request her assistance again.” — Lateefah
“Students struggling in math should seek help from Reza. He is patient, composed, and adept at explaining complex concepts in a clear and understandable way. He is also very generous with his time and willing to assist students on short notice.” — Rajasiva

“Sierra provided me with an exceptional tutoring session in chemistry. She was patient and made sure that I fully comprehended every concept. I am grateful for her assistance.” — Erin

“Michael did an excellent job in assisting me to comprehend various types of isomers. His tips and tricks were beneficial in resolving challenging problems.” — Jada

“I have found Anisha to be an exceptionally patient tutor who provides clear explanations that have helped me to comprehend various topics. I would strongly recommend her to anyone who needs assistance.” — Sam

“I received invaluable assistance from Patrick in terms of the direction for my papers. Collaborating with him was a comfortable experience, and it made the writing process much more manageable.” — Stephanie

“Elena's assistance was invaluable to me during my college essay revision session on Greek Mythology for the Humanities subject. She provided positive and helpful feedback and demonstrated expertise in several areas, which she explained very nicely.” — Abigail
